'''Flying Tiles''' are irritating traps that appear in multiple ''[[The Legend of Zelda (Series)|''The Legend of Zelda]]'' games. They are similar to [[Flying Jar]]s in that they fly at [[Link]] when he nears them, but they are often laid out in patterns. | |||

Flying | ===A Link to the Past=== | ||
Flying Tiles appear in many dungeons in ''[[The Legend of Zelda: A Link to the Past|A Link to the Past]]''. The tiles attack one at a time, and leave some design on the floor once they have all attacked Link. | |||
== | ===Link's Awakening=== | ||
Flying Tiles in ''[[The Legend of Zelda: Link's Awakening|Link's Awakening]]'' serve a similar purpose as they do in ''A Link to the Past'', but now, occasional sets leave holes in the floor where they originally were. | |||
===Ocarina of Time=== | |||
Flying Tiles are found in the [[Fire Temple (Ocarina of Time)|Fire Temple]] in ''[[The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time|Ocarina of Time]]''. The floor tiles themselves float up and fly towards Link. They can be destroyed with just about anything, but probably the sword or [[Deku Nut]]s work the best. The better alternative is to simply use a shield, or just dodge them. | |||
===Oracle of Seasons and Oracle of Ages=== | |||
In the ''Oracle'' series, Flying Tiles are found in dungeons, and function the same way they do in ''Link's Awakening''. | |||
